Output d70caf654e5e1676f28034458ae474f0ad77b6fcb76560ea40b61bbdcfb6ff60:6

value
108205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a4f8fa7a803e6e5cc09d0ed30b36d3ac67cfd42 OP_EQUAL
address
35Yjcc88NpTf3ELKGdbmnJVTSgV7DyPkxS
transaction
d70caf654e5e1676f28034458ae474f0ad77b6fcb76560ea40b61bbdcfb6ff60